WHO YOU WILL WORK WITH
Your key design partners will include: Apparel Design Directors and Senior Creative Directors for Product. Key cross-functional partners include: Business Product Directors and Business VP Leaders; Dimensional Merchandising leaders; Development Directors; Design and Product Operation Directors and Managers.
WHO WE ARE LOOKING FOR
We are looking for a creative Apparel Color Design Director for Jordan Sport! If this is you, you will be a cultural expert with a deep understanding of what drives the Jordan consumer as well as knowledge of cultural trends and behaviors. You are also a creative powerhouse with an excellent taste level to drive the future look of Jordan Apparel. You are also a seasoned team leader who believes in the power of diversity to foster strong and dynamic teams.
Education
- Bachelor's Degree or higher in Design or related field or combination of relevant education, experience, and training. Will accept any suitable combination of education, experience and training
- 10 years' prior design work experience, 2+ years’ managing experience
- Extensive experience creating color palettes and concepts and exploring new color blocking and application strategies
- Product Color experience mandatory
- Strong understanding of the Apparel Product Creation process
- Experience working and communicating directly with manufacturing partners to ensure the accuracy of Color application and execution
- Understanding of how the partnership with Brand on Color narratives operates
- Experience managing other designers and leading strategic design direction
- Demonstrates leadership that influences process change
- Leads in depth research on consumer trends, insights, competitors, for a focused market segment/category
- Experience building inspiration/concept presentations, and mood boards for seasonal concepts and direction
WHAT YOU WILL WORK ON
As the Apparel Color Design Director, Jordan Sport, you will be responsible for providing color solutions that lead to product and marketing success, including trend research and selection of the seasonal color palette and its application on product. You will management and provide input into succession planning and segmentation activities and be responsible for performance management, pay, and resourcing decisions for direct and indirect reports.
